How they compare

Eritrea currently reports 0.0558 current US$ per US$ of GDP against 0.0537 current US$ per US$ of GDP in Malta, a difference of 0.0021 current US$ per US$ of GDP.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 17 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Malta ahead.

Eritrea ranks 141st and Malta ranks 144th of 181 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Eritrea averaged higher in 1 and Malta in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Eritrea Malta Difference Ahead
1990s 0.1117 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.4197 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.308 current US$ per US$ of GDP Malta
2000s 0.0349 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.3644 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.3295 current US$ per US$ of GDP Malta
2010s 0.0638 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.055 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.0089 current US$ per US$ of GDP Eritrea

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
